    Truth be told, trucks are not the be all end all. Your peeps can get a cargo van or mini van. He could even go the extra mile and get his own pet transport business going.

    Get errors and omissions insurance. DBA. Get himself some paid subscriptions to some.breed specific dog websites.

    Get yourself some pet carriers of all sizes. Some cleaning supplies. A 50lb bag of high end dog food. A few bowls..couple jugs of water.

    Advertise on the dog forums that you've paid yearly memberships to. Don't forget to mention fees for puppies versus adult dogs. Be specific on what you consider a "puppy".

    In no time, the phone will ring so much, you'd soon forget about a CDL.

    It really depends on the felony. There are companies that will take rehabilitated felons under certain conditions. Generally the biggest causes for 'No-Go'ing a candidate is crimes of 1.Child Abuse 2. Assault 3. Theft
    The timeline is also relevant. Either way it's generally up to a company's Operations Manager to provide the final say.

    No Canada. That's out. Felons don't get to go to Canada.

    No Hazmat. That's out. I don't know about TWIC or other secured locations enough to say one way or another.

    You can probably get a basic local dump truck throwing down pavement or stones etc. It's not much but compared to Prison it's freedom.
